Page 186 - FIX MODUL_Neat
P. 186
Register Alamat Memori (Memory Address Register,
MAR)
MAR berfungsi menerjemahkan alamat yang diterima dari
pencacah program dan memposisikan pada alamat
instruksi dan data dalam memori.
Memori 64 KB
Memori berkapasitas 64 KB dengan lebar data 8 bit.
Memori dibagi menjadi dua bagian. Alamat awal
digunakan untuk program monitor yang terletak pada 2 KB
alamat pertama dalam memori, dari 0000 H sampai 07FF
H. Program dan data diletakan mulai alamat 0800 H sampai
FFFF H sebanyak 62 KB. Program monintor berfungsi
menampilkan masukan-masukan papan tombol dan
kondisi-kondisi yang terjadi selama proses. Bagian ini
mempermudah pengguna untuk mengetahui proses yang
sedang dikerjakan prosesor.
Register Data Memori (Memory Data Register, MDR)
MDR adalah sebuah register tempat menyimpan sementara
data yang dibaca atau akan dimasukan ke dalam memori.
Pada saat operasi membaca memori (Memory Read), data
dalam memori akan masuk ke dalam MDR untuk
diteruskan ke bus W. Pada saat operasi menulis memori
(Memory Write) data dari bus W akan diteruskan ke dalam
memori.
174